Athens's West Elementary School serves grades K-6 in the Athens City School District. It has received a GreatSchools Rating of 6 out of 10, based on its performance on state standardized tests.

This school has an average Community Rating of 4 out of 5 stars, based on reviews from 15 school community members.

We open-enrolled our two sons at West last year and could not be happier. The principal welcomes parent involvement and initiative, and the teachers I have encountered do as well. As the mother of a classic spirited child, I'm glad there are experienced teachers on hand who aren't fazed by squirrelly little boys! Every teacher's style is different. My advice to parents who are having problems with a teacher is to schedule a meeting with the principal right away. You are your child's advocate, and personality clashes between children and teachers will happen. Work with the school to ensure that your child's needs are met -- they will work with you. If your child's teacher isn't interested in parental involvement, there's always PTO. Ours is an active and vital organization that embraces participation at all levels. West is a terrific school community. I recommend it without reservation.
